Yahiyapur

Yahiyapur is a village located in Konch subdivision of Gaya district in Bihar,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Konch (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Gaya. As per 2009 stats, Kurmawan is the gram panchayat of Yahiyapur village.

About Yahiyap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Yahiyapur is 254675. The village spans a total geographical area of 101 hectares. Tikari is nearest town to Yahiyap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Yahiyapur

Below is a concise population overview of Yahiyapur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 988 537 451
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 128 71 57
Scheduled Castes (SC) 30 20 10
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 730 433 297
Illiterate Population 258 104 154

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Yahiyapur village:

  • The total population of Yahiyapur village is around 988, including approximately 537 males and 451 females, with a sex ratio of 839 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 128 children aged 0–6 years in Yahiyapur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Yahiyapur village has 30 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Yahiyapur village is about 73.89%, with male literacy at 80.63% and female literacy at 65.85%.
  • There are around 133 households in Yahiyapur village.

Connectivity of Yahiyap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Yahiyapur. As per the 2011 stats, Yahiyap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
